If `y = tan^(-1)(u/sqrt(1-u^2))` and `x = sec^(-1)(1/(2u^2-1))`, ` u in (0,1/sqrt2)uu(1/sqrt2,1)`, prove that `2dy/dx+ 1 = 0`.
